72 changes: 72 additions & 0 deletions pkg/autodetect/operatorconfig.go
Original file line number Diff line number Diff line change
@@ -0,0 +1,72 @@
package autodetect

import (
"strings"
"sync"

"github.com/spf13/viper"

v1 "github.com/jaegertracing/jaeger-operator/apis/v1"
)

// Platform holds the auto-detected running platform.
type Platform int

const (
// KubernetesPlatform represents the cluster is Kubernetes.
KubernetesPlatform Platform = iota

// OpenShiftPlatform represents the cluster is OpenShift.
OpenShiftPlatform
)

func (p Platform) String() string {
return [...]string{"Kubernetes", "OpenShift"}[p]
}

var OperatorConfiguration operatorConfigurationWrapper

type operatorConfigurationWrapper struct {
mu sync.RWMutex
}

func (c *operatorConfigurationWrapper) SetPlatform(p interface{}) {
var platform string
switch v := p.(type) {
case string:
platform = v
case Platform:
platform = v.String()
default:
platform = KubernetesPlatform.String()
}

c.mu.Lock()
viper.Set(v1.FlagPlatform, platform)
c.mu.Unlock()
}

func (c *operatorConfigurationWrapper) GetPlatform() Platform {
c.mu.RLock()
p := viper.GetString(v1.FlagPlatform)
c.mu.RUnlock()

p = strings.ToLower(p)

var platform Platform
switch p {
case "openshift":
platform = OpenShiftPlatform
default:
platform = KubernetesPlatform
}
return platform
}

func (c *operatorConfigurationWrapper) IsPlatformAutodetectionEnabled() bool {
c.mu.RLock()
p := viper.GetString(v1.FlagPlatform)
c.mu.RUnlock()

return strings.EqualFold(p, "auto-detect")
}
